Iron is essential to maintain the process of erythropoiesis. Insufficiency results in adverse

consequences in iron-poor erythropoiesis, which, if persistent, reasons iron deficiency anemia.

Anemia is a common clinical sickness within side the globe and impacts greater than 2.36

billion (32.1%) inhabitants. In sufferers scheduled for surgery, about one 1/3 suffers from preoperative anemia.

Our research focuses on effect of dates on Hemoglobin level, partial pressure of Oxygen, pulse rate, and blood group of individuals. The first 4 months of the study include baseline data

collection of 40 individuals of different age groups and lifestyles. Using oximeter, the partial

pressure of Oxygen is noticed regularly of the subjects. The Hemoglobin is checked once before

the research starts. Also, blood sugar level, pulse rate and cholesterol of these subjects are

checked to notice the effect on each once the study ends. The main goal is to take the readings of

Hb, pulse rate, and PO2 as mentioned above for at least 180 days i.e., 8 months.

The second part of the research involves daily intake of dates by individuals and checking their partial pressure of Oxygen daily using oximeter. Blood sugar level and cholesterol of these

individuals are also checked between these months (once in 2 months). The Hemoglobin level is

checked again when the research ends to check the difference in levels after daily intake of dates.

We expect a high content of dissolved oxygen in the blood of individuals with regular date

intake. The positive effect of Iron on blood pressure, cholesterol, and blood glucose and sugar

level is also expected to observe in subjects.

In the next phase, we shall develop a bioinformatics tool and apply it to the statistical data obtained. This tool predicts Hb level on the basis of dietary, partial pressure of oxygen, and biometric data.

Steps involved in using Oximeters

An oximeter will be used during our project, which measures the oxygen saturation of hemoglobin in arterial blood and pulse rate.

  • Position your finger in the device correctly such that it should point towards the LED light or detector of the device.
  • Now, wait for a few minutes till the detector takes the readings.
  • With the beep sound, two different readings will appear on the monitor of the detector; Oxygen saturation % of the blood and pulse rate.
  • An oxygen saturation level of 95 to 100% is considered normal.

The pulse rate ranges from 60 to 100 beats per minute is considered normal.

Steps involved in using hemoglobin kits 

The hemoglobin kits are handheld devices that can be used conveniently to check hemoglobin levels.

  • The HB testing system includes one HB meter, 10 test strips, and one code chip to control strips, 10 lancets, one lancet device, and one test strip insert.
  • Insert the correct code chip into the code chip slot of the device. Then press and hold the power button for four seconds. Now proceed to set up the units to either g/dL or g/L or mmol/L and save anyone of them.
  • Take the lancet holder and insert a sterile lancet into it. This device is used to obtain a drop of blood. 
  • Take one test strip and insert it into the strip channel of the device. Ensure that the test strip is inserted properly into the channel. Now massage the hands to encourage blood flow and clean the testing site by using alcohol swabs.
  • Now use the lancet device to draw the blood of the specimen. Collect the blood of around 10 microliters using the capillary transfer tube or pipette.

Now apply the blood sample to the application area of the test strip, the device will begin to test automatically and will show the results on the screen within 15 seconds.
